Trinten is a boy's name of Latin origin. A compound creation blending Trinity with the -ten suffix (associated with Scandinavian and Germanic names like Kirsten, Karsten), Trinten merges spiritual meaning with a Nordic-influenced sound. The name has an outdoorsy, adventurous quality while honoring the threefold concept at its root.
The -ten ending connects to Germanic/Scandinavian naming traditions while being applied to a spiritual base.
